Manufactured Precision Parts: Finishing with Anodizing and Polishing
Dealing with raising the appearance and merit of CNC produced components, anodic treatment and glossing provide significant contributions. These treatments improve end-item appeal and reinforce protection from abrasion and fatigue.
Anodic oxidation is a technique that deposits an oxide film electrochemically on metal surfaces, improving rust protection and providing multiple attractive finishes. At the same time, refining clears flaws from surfaces, delivering a sleek and shiny result. The blend of both methods secures an outstanding surface that is alluring in appearance and tough in use.
